I’d like to give a plug to Deadline’s newest MMC sibling site, TVLine.com, which covers the consumer-oriented content side of television (while we cover the business). Debuting over a week ago under the leadership of
editor-in-chief Michael Ausiello, TVline has more than tripled initial traffic expectations and blown past its January goals within the first six days. It has shown promising signs of engagement with over 1,000 comments on the first day alone. Credit belongs to Ausiello’s diehard fanbase, who followed him from Entertainment Weekly to his new gig, and also to the impressive team he has assembled, including Matt Webb Mitovich, Megan Masters, and Michael Slezak as well as an occasional contributor you all know and love, Deadline’s TV Editor Nellie Andreeva. Together, Team TVLine has broken more than 50 stories in its first week alone. Check it out.
